The Emirates Flight Training Academy (EFTA) has ordered three twin-engine DA42-VIs and their corresponding flight simulators from Austria-based Diamond Aircraft Industries to strengthen its existing fleet.
The total transaction value is EUR 4 million (list price).
AUSTRO’s jet fuel powered DA42-VI aircraft will be the flagship aircraft for EFTA’s Multi Engine Piston (MEP) training.

The 4-seat DA42-VI is the latest version of Diamond’s technology-leading lightweight piston twin-engine aircraft. It was the first certified general aviation piston aircraft to incorporate a modern technological airframe, avionics and powerplant.
With its unique combination of performance and practicality, the jet-fuel-powered DA42-VI is designed to make the transition from single-engine to twin-engine easier. The aircraft offers fuel savings of up to 50% compared to conventional AVGAS powered twins, and its panoramic canopy provides excellent visibility during all flight maneuvers.
Since its introduction, more than 1,100 DA42 aircraft have been delivered, more than all other certified piston twin aircraft combined. The all composite DA42-VI is equipped with an efficient, quiet, clean and reliable 168hp jet fuel AUSTRO engine AE300, Garmin G1000 NXi with 3 axis automatic flight control system and optional electric air conditioning.
Aircraft deliveries are expected to begin soon, with all three aircraft to be received by EFTA in the first half of 2023. Since 2020, more than 100 trainees have successfully graduated from EFTA, creating a strong pilot pipeline for Emirates and the industry as a whole. – trade arab news agency
